What Does a FHA Loan Specialist in Geneva Cost?

Typical costs for an FHA loan in Illinois include an upfront mortgage insurance premium of 1.75 percent of the loan amount and an annual premium of 0.55 to 0.85 percent. Closing costs in Geneva range from 2 to 5 percent of the purchase price. Lender fees origination fees and appraisal costs vary by lender. Frequently Asked Questions

What are the minimum credit score requirements for an FHA loan in Geneva Illinois?
FHA loans generally require a minimum credit score of 580 for a 3.5 percent down payment. Borrowers with scores between 500 and 579 may qualify with a 10 percent down payment. Illinois lenders may apply additional overlays beyond FHA minimums.
Are there specific property condition rules for FHA loans in Illinois?
Yes FHA requires a property appraisal that meets minimum health and safety standards. In Illinois the appraiser must check for lead-based paint hazards in homes built before 1978. The property must also have adequate heating and a safe water supply.
How long does the FHA loan process take in Geneva Illinois?
The typical FHA loan process in Illinois takes 30 to 45 days from application to closing. This includes appraisal underwriting and final approval. Delays can occur if the property requires repairs to meet FHA standards.
